📜 History & Lineage
📍 Origin: Isle of Man, United Kingdom
Originating naturally around 800 AD on the Isle of Man in the Irish Sea, this breed is characterized by a genetic mutation resulting in a lack of tail, which was purely preserved and spread in the island's isolated environment. Their resilience was proven by their exceptional hunting prowess in the harsh climate of the Isle of Man, earning them the role of "rat-catching warriors" for local farmers. 🏥 Medical Warnings
⚠ Manx Syndrome
Due to the genetic mutation causing tail degeneration, spinal deformities and neurological development abnormalities can occur. This can lead to severe "hardware bugs" such as loss of bladder/bowel control and hind leg paralysis. Careful observation and early diagnosis are therefore crucial.
⚠ Vulnerability to Joint and Spinal Diseases
While their short spinal structure and powerful hind leg jumping ability are charming, they can place long-term strain on the spine and joints, leading to a higher incidence of degenerative arthritis. Manx Tail Types: "Hardware Architecture" Comparative Analysis
| Tail Type | Characteristics | Medical Considerations |
|---|---|---|
| Rumpy | Completely tailless or with a dimple | Highest risk of Manx Syndrome. Perianal hygiene is essential. |
| Riser | 2-3 vertebrae that slightly rise when moving | Lower risk of Manx Syndrome, but still possible. Regular check-ups recommended. |
| Stumpy | Short residual tail bone (1-3cm) or knot-like | Tail movement may be restricted, causing discomfort. Caution against trauma. |
| Longy | Tail length similar to an ordinary cat (partially short) | May be a carrier of the Manx gene, but externally, tail length is near normal. Genetic testing is available. |

🎨 Recognized Colors
Almost all coat colors and patterns, excluding color points, are expressed like a "universal patch", including white, black, red, cream, blue, lynx point, bicolor, tabby, tortoiseshell, and calico. Eye colors typically harmonize with the coat, but odd-eyes can also be found.

1️⃣ Manx Syndrome "Debugging" and Early Warning System Implementation
Manx Syndrome often manifests within the first four weeks of life. Do not overlook subtle "error codes" such as abnormal gait, difficulty controlling bowel/bladder movements, or hind leg weakness. Regular health check-ups should be used to analyze "system logs", and any unusual signs should prompt immediate consultation with a veterinarian for "patch application".
